Show Notes

The plight of the people of Palestine cannot be summarized in a statement or covered by one or two podcasts. Recently, Human Rights Watch issued a report titled “A Threshold Crossed” detailing their position and accusing the Israeli authorities of the crimes of apartheid and persecution. Today’s conversation is with an Arab-American who decided to move back to Palestine and be involved in advocacy and activism by working with humanitarian organizations and international human rights groups. We will cover day-to-day life of ordinary Palestinians and talk about efforts by various local and international organizations to help, advocate on their behalf, and provide them support. And we'll also learn few things about skateboarding in Palestine.
